For this cache don't go to the cords listed. The cache is there just 15 feet under ground. to get to it you must start at the trail head way point tere is a retention pond with a storm drain entrance. The catacombs. . I would not do this cash if you are super tall or closterfobic or affread of snakes spyders. 

For this cache it will be easy going in the catacombs untill you reach the second to last chamber forome here you will have to climb a latter and leen across about a ten foot drop and climb accrose to the oppesot wall. then trou the tube and you will find the cache.

Garry. Garry is a gardener snake that lives in the junction in the catacombs (see pic) he moves bettween the second and third chambers. please watch out for him and do not hurt him. if you can send me a pic of him.

 

Supplies Flash light(I have a 150$ super bright and i could only see 6 feet ahead) backpack knee pads helmet water bottle gloves GPS old shoes(they will get wet and dirty) a rope and carabiner (for the last bit i had to drag my backpack behind me (it's so tight in there). clip the carabiner to the loop on your backpack then tie the rope around your waist )
